Low voltage
The technical and contractual conditions for low-voltage connection are based on the current version of the Ordinance on General Conditions for Grid Connection and its Use for Low-Voltage Electricity Supply – the Low-Voltage Connection Ordinance (NAV). The TAB Low Voltage applies to the connection and operation of installations which, in accordance with Section 1(1) of the NAV, are connected or are to be connected to the network operator’s low-voltage network. These Technical Connection Conditions form an integral part of grid connection contracts and connection usage agreements in accordance with the NAV.
In addition to the NAV, SWK’s Supplementary Conditions to the NAV also apply.
